Plate 1 issued from : J.M. Bradford, L. Haakonssen & J.B. Jillett in Mem. N.Z. Oceanogr. Inst., 1983, 90. [p.58, Fig.31]. Female: A, genital segment (dorsal); B, genital prominence (right lateral view); C, genital segment (left lateral view); D, genital field (ventral); E, exopod of P1; F, exopod segment 3 of P2.
Nota: - Posterolateral corners of metasome not produced, and broadly rounded in dorsal and lateral view. - Genital segment symmetrical in dorsal view, widest part anterior to middle; ventral wall anterior to genital prominence very depressed in lateral view; genital prominence high and almost perpendicular to segment; genital flanges large and extend over entire length of genital field; lobe-like process extends from posteromedial border of flange in ventral view; left process of genital flange larger than right, in lateralview seen as ventrally directed lobe from posterior part of genital flange. - Appendicular caudal setae geniculate. - None of the 6 distal setae of Mx2 covered with long spines in addition to short spinules. - None of the long setae on endopod of Mxp terminate in spinule. - P1 exopod: Aa minute; Bb = 6/7 BC; Cc > BC. - P2 exopod: Aa = AB; Bb = 1/2 BC; Cc = 7/9 CD; Dd = 1/3 CD.
